Fabric History/Pedigree: 1930s-50s silk fabric pieces received from traditional Japanese kimono cleaner/reconstructor called Arai-Hari -- see an excellent explanation of traditional Arai Hari by textile expert John Marshall,by click-pushing HERE.

Fabric Description: This 1930s-1950s kimono silk is a lightweight fabric, slightly translucent; Background color is off-white with black-bordered odd obtuse shapes interlocked as a puzzle; truly another modernistic, perhaps abstractionist look from early post-World War 2 1950s' Japan; dominant colors used are shades of black, with browns, grays, tan, peach, pink and reds;  Motifs are same on both sides (Please see close-ups).
